The Einstein-Rosen Bridge: A Wormhole to the Past?

Einstein’s theories have offered the most potent fuel for time-travel debates among physicists. The Einstein-Rosen Bridge, more widely known as a wormhole, provides a tunnel-like shortcut through spacetime. But could Senku actually build one? Considering he made antibiotics from scratch in a stone-age setting, I wouldn’t put it past him. It’ll be fascinating to see if the manga brings real-world theories like negative energy to tackle the enormous gravitational forces inside a wormhole.

The Grandfather Paradox: A Kink in the Plan

While the series is known for its scientific accuracy, it’s also no stranger to moral dilemmas. Enter the Grandfather Paradox: what happens if Senku goes back in time and prevents his ancestors from meeting? Does he cease to exist? This conundrum is ripe for exploring not just scientific but also ethical quandaries, a dual challenge that Senku would likely relish.
